Background

Foxy is a major antagonist in the Five Nights at Freddy's series. Foxy is a discontinued animatronic pirate fox entertainer housed at Freddy Fazbear's Pizza. He resides at his own separate stage in the pizzeria. Secretly, Foxy and the other animatronics are haunted by children murdered by a man named William Afton. He and the others are now seeking revenge against their killer by attacking any adults in the pizzeria after-hours in blind rage. He was the pirate fox entertainer when the first Freddy Fazbear's Pizza was opened in 1983 (however, it's unknown if he was discontinued or not). In 1987, he and the original animatronics had all fallen into severe disrepair and Foxy was replaced by his newer counterpart for the "improved" Freddy Fazbear's Pizza, Mangle. After the pizzeria's closing, as well as the Toy Animatronics being scrapped, he and the original animatronics were refurbished for the new pizzeria, as of the events of the first game. However, after the closure of the new pizzeria, he and the other animatronics got dismantled by their killer. His soul, along with the others, was presumably set free, as evidenced by the good ending.

Standard Tactics:

Also, check on the curtain in Pirate Cove from time to time. The character in there seems unique in that he becomes more active if the cameras remain off for long periods of time. I guess he doesn't like being watched. I don't know...
~ Night 2 Phone Call
Due to being within an animatronic, each animatronic has a movement cycle they go by, Foxy's starting location is behind the curtain in Pirate Cove, from which he will emerge and sprint towards the Office to attack the night guard on any given night if he is not monitored enough. Unlike the other animatronics in the game, Foxy will hide for a while before coming to attack the night guard on the first night.

Uh, did you ever see Foxy the pirate? Oh wait, Foxy... ..oh yeah, Foxy! Uh...hey, listen! Uh, that one was always a bit twitchy, uh... ..I'm not sure if the Freddy head trick will work on Foxy. Uh, if for some reason he activates during the night, and you see him standing at the far end of the hall, uh, just flash your light at him from time to time. Those older models would always get disoriented with bright lights. It would cause a... ..system restart or something.
~ Night 2 Phone Call
He starts at the Parts/Service area before making his way to the hallway outside the Office and after 50 seconds will try to pounce the night guard from there. Parts/Service is the only room in which Withered Foxy will appear on camera. If all of the other animatronics have already left, he can appear standing in the middle of the room. He will also come directly back here when the player manages to repel him. Withered Foxy will then make his way back to the hallway outside of the Office.

Foxy resides in Pirate Cove alongside Bonnie. Like in the original Five Nights at Freddy's, the player must check him (but only if the figurine on the player's desk has changed to him) to slow down his attack, or else he'll escape and reach the Office. Once he's reached the Office, he will take himself apart and his pieces will be slid in through any open door or vent. Once all of his pieces are in the Office, he will reassemble himself and jumpscare the player.

Weaknesses: If it hits 6 AM, the animatronic no longer targets and resorts to its daytime functions[61]. The older models are disoriented by bright lights, causing a system restart[62]. Looking at the withered models on the camera causes them to not move[63].
